Is the Purifier safe?Updated 21 days ago

Yes. We currently have two types of Purifier. Both contain Sodium Percarbonate, which is a common cleaning ingredient, effective and safe to sanitise your Pinter.

The only difference is the amount of Sodium Percarbonate:

  • One type contains a very small amount of Sodium Percarbonate, which does not require any special labelling.

  • The other contains a higher amount, which means it must carry a Limited Quantity (LQ) label for shipping. This label is purely a transport requirement for small amounts of oxidising substances. It does not affect the safety of using the product at home.

How to use it:

  • Always use the full sachet each time you clean your Pinter to ensure proper sanitisation.

  • For full safety guidance, check the product label.

  • Step-by-step cleaning instructions are available in the Pinter App.
